Abstract

The article analyzes available methods for preventing acoustic resonance of high pressure lamps. A new method is proposed, the main idea of which is the filing of a high-voltage lamp modulated by a pseudo-random signal. An analysis of the spectral characteristics of the signal entering the lamp is made, the mathematical modeling of the set of a “discharge lamp - prototype of the device” - is implemented, which implements the proposed control method of the lamp. The results of simulation and oscillograms, taken from the prototype, which confirms the results of theoretical research, are presented.
